28 #include <sys/cdefs.h>
29 __KERNEL_RCSID(0, "$NetBSD: armadillo9_iic.c,v 1.1 2005/11/13 06:33:05 hamajima Exp $");
30
31 #include <sys/param.h>
32 #include <sys/systm.h>
33 #include <sys/kernel.h>
34 #include <sys/device.h>
35 #include <sys/lock.h>
36 #include <dev/i2c/i2cvar.h>
37 #include <dev/i2c/i2c_bitbang.h>
38 #include <arm/ep93xx/epsocvar.h>
39 #include <arm/ep93xx/epgpiovar.h>
40
41 #include "seeprom.h"
42 #if NSEEPROM > 0
43 #include <net/if.h>
44 #include <net/if_ether.h>
45 #include <dev/i2c/at24cxxvar.h>
46 #endif
47
48 struct armadillo9iic_softc {
49 struct device sc_dev;
50 struct i2c_controller sc_i2c;
51 struct lock sc_buslock;
52 int sc_port;
53 int sc_sda;
54 int sc_scl;
55 struct epgpio_softc *sc_gpio;
56 };
57
58 static int armadillo9iic_match(struct device *, struct cfdata *, void *);
59 static void armadillo9iic_attach(struct device *, struct device *, void *);
60
61 static int armadillo9iic_acquire_bus(void *, int);
62 static void armadillo9iic_release_bus(void *, int);
63 static int armadillo9iic_send_start(void *, int);
64 static int armadillo9iic_send_stop(void *, int);
65 static int armadillo9iic_initiate_xfer(void *, uint16_t, int);
66 static int armadillo9iic_read_byte(void *, uint8_t *, int);
67 static int armadillo9iic_write_byte(void *, uint8_t, int);
68
69 static void armadillo9iic_bb_set_bits(void *, uint32_t);
70 static void armadillo9iic_bb_set_dir(void *, uint32_t);
71 static uint32_t armadillo9iic_bb_read_bits(void *);
72
73 CFATTACH_DECL(armadillo9iic, sizeof(struct armadillo9iic_softc),
74 armadillo9iic_match, armadillo9iic_attach, NULL, NULL);
75
76 static struct i2c_bitbang_ops armadillo9iic_bbops = {
77 armadillo9iic_bb_set_bits,
78 armadillo9iic_bb_set_dir,
79 armadillo9iic_bb_read_bits,
80 { 0, 0, 0, 0 } /* set in attach() */
81 };
82
83 int
84 armadillo9iic_match(struct device *parent, struct cfdata *cf, void *aux)
85 {
86 return 2;
87 }
88
89 void
90 armadillo9iic_attach(struct device *parent, struct device *self, void *aux)
91 {
92 struct armadillo9iic_softc *sc = (struct armadillo9iic_softc*)self;
93 struct i2cbus_attach_args iba;
94 #if NSEEPROM > 0
95 struct epgpio_attach_args *ga = aux;
96 u_int8_t enaddr[ETHER_ADDR_LEN];
97 #endif
98 lockinit(&sc->sc_buslock, PRIBIO|PCATCH, "armadillo9iiclk", 0, 0);
99
100 sc->sc_port = ga->ga_port;
101 sc->sc_sda = ga->ga_bit1;
102 sc->sc_scl = ga->ga_bit2;
103 sc->sc_gpio = (struct epgpio_softc *)parent;
104
105 armadillo9iic_bbops.ibo_bits[I2C_BIT_SDA] = (1<<sc->sc_sda);
106 armadillo9iic_bbops.ibo_bits[I2C_BIT_SCL] = (1<<sc->sc_scl);
107 armadillo9iic_bbops.ibo_bits[I2C_BIT_OUTPUT] = sc->sc_sda;
108 armadillo9iic_bbops.ibo_bits[I2C_BIT_INPUT] = 0;
109
110 sc->sc_i2c.ic_cookie = sc;
111 sc->sc_i2c.ic_acquire_bus = armadillo9iic_acquire_bus;
112 sc->sc_i2c.ic_release_bus = armadillo9iic_release_bus;
113 sc->sc_i2c.ic_send_start = armadillo9iic_send_start;
114 sc->sc_i2c.ic_send_stop = armadillo9iic_send_stop;
115 sc->sc_i2c.ic_initiate_xfer = armadillo9iic_initiate_xfer;
116 sc->sc_i2c.ic_read_byte = armadillo9iic_read_byte;
117 sc->sc_i2c.ic_write_byte = armadillo9iic_write_byte;
118
119 iba.iba_name = "iic";
120 iba.iba_tag = &sc->sc_i2c;
121
122 epgpio_in(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_sda);
123 epgpio_out(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_scl);
124 epgpio_set(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_scl);
125
126 printf("\n");
127
128 config_found(&sc->sc_dev, &iba, iicbus_print);
129
130 #if NSEEPROM > 0
131 /* read and set mac address */
132 if (!seeprom_bootstrap_read(&sc->sc_i2c, 0x50, 0x00, 128,
133 (uint8_t *)enaddr, ETHER_ADDR_LEN)
134 && (prop_set(dev_propdb, 0, "mac-addr",
135 enaddr, ETHER_ADDR_LEN, PROP_ARRAY, 0) != 0)) {
136 printf("WARNING: unable to set mac-addr property for %s\n",
137 sc->sc_dev.dv_xname);
138 }
139 #endif
140 }
141
142 int
143 armadillo9iic_acquire_bus(void *cookie, int flags)
144 {
145 struct armadillo9iic_softc *sc = cookie;
146
147 /* XXX What should we do for the polling case? */
148 if (flags & I2C_F_POLL)
149 return 0;
150
151 return lockmgr(&sc->sc_buslock, LK_EXCLUSIVE, NULL);
152 }
153
154 void
155 armadillo9iic_release_bus(void *cookie, int flags)
156 {
157 struct armadillo9iic_softc *sc = cookie;
158
159 /* XXX See above. */
160 if (flags & I2C_F_POLL)
161 return;
162
163 lockmgr(&sc->sc_buslock, LK_RELEASE, NULL);
164 }
165
166 int
167 armadillo9iic_send_start(void *cookie, int flags)
168 {
169 return i2c_bitbang_send_start(cookie, flags, &armadillo9iic_bbops);
170 }
171
172 int
173 armadillo9iic_send_stop(void *cookie, int flags)
174 {
175 return i2c_bitbang_send_stop(cookie, flags, &armadillo9iic_bbops);
176 }
177
178 int
179 armadillo9iic_initiate_xfer(void *cookie, i2c_addr_t addr, int flags)
180 {
181 return i2c_bitbang_initiate_xfer(cookie, addr, flags,
182 &armadillo9iic_bbops);
183 }
184
185 int
186 armadillo9iic_read_byte(void *cookie, uint8_t *bytep, int flags)
187 {
188 return i2c_bitbang_read_byte(cookie, bytep, flags,
189 &armadillo9iic_bbops);
190 }
191
192 int
193 armadillo9iic_write_byte(void *cookie, uint8_t byte, int flags)
194 {
195 return i2c_bitbang_write_byte(cookie, byte, flags,
196 &armadillo9iic_bbops);
197 }
198
199 void
200 armadillo9iic_bb_set_bits(void *cookie, uint32_t bits)
201 {
202 struct armadillo9iic_softc *sc = cookie;
203
204 if (bits & (1 << sc->sc_sda))
205 epgpio_set(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_sda);
206 else
207 epgpio_clear(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_sda);
208
209 if (bits & (1 << sc->sc_scl))
210 epgpio_set(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_scl);
211 else
212 epgpio_clear(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_scl);
213 }
214
215 void
216 armadillo9iic_bb_set_dir(void *cookie, uint32_t bits)
217 {
218 struct armadillo9iic_softc *sc = cookie;
219
220 if(bits)
221 epgpio_out(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_sda);
222 else
223 epgpio_in(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_sda);
224 }
225
226 uint32_t
227 armadillo9iic_bb_read_bits(void *cookie)
228 {
229 struct armadillo9iic_softc *sc = cookie;
230
231 return epgpio_read(sc->sc_gpio, sc->sc_port, sc->sc_sda) << sc->sc_sda;
232 }
